Chamber approves increase in paternity leave

A unanimously approved this Tuesday (4) the extension of paternity leave from 5 to 20 days. The approved project foresees that the law will come into force on January 1, 2027, however, for validation, the text will still undergo new analysis by the Federal Senate, which, if approved, will proceed to presidential sanction. The measure applies to employees who are parents, adopt or obtain legal custody of a child or teenager, and will be implemented in three stages. According to the text, paternity leave will be:

  • 10 days, from the first to the second year of the law’s validity;
  • 15 days, from the second to the third year of the law’s validity;
  • 20 days from the fourth year of force of the law.

The proposal to extend maternity leave is from rapporteur Pedro Campos (PSB-PE) and the initial text spoke of an increase of up to 30 days, which would be implemented progressively over five years, starting with 10 days and increasing every five days until reaching 30 days from the fifth year onwards. However, there was a change so that there was agreement with the opposition.

The financial impact of the expansion estimated by the rapporteur is R$5 billion per year, and the leave can be divided into two periods, except in cases of death of the mother, in addition to the project, prohibiting the employee from being dismissed without just cause within a period of up to one month after the end of paternity leave. During the period of absence, beneficiaries will be entitled to full salary, subject to the ceiling established by Social Security.
